Cheesy Taco Sticks Easy and Flavorful Snack Idea
Ingredients
- 1 package refrigerated crescent roll dough
- 1 cup cooked ground beef (or turkey)
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/2 cup taco seasoning (store-bought or homemade)
- 1/4 cup diced tomatoes (fresh or canned)
- 1/4 cup black olives, sliced (optional)
- 1/4 cup green onions, chopped
- 1 egg for egg wash
- to taste Sour cream and salsa for serving
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a skillet over medium heat, cook the ground beef (or turkey) until fully browned. Drain excess fat and stir in taco seasoning, diced tomatoes, and black olives.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until heated through.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
- Unroll the crescent roll dough and separate it into four rectangles (press the seams together to seal).
- On each rectangle, place a spoonful of the meat mixture in the center, sprinkle with shredded cheddar cheese and a few chopped green onions.
- Fold the dough over the filling to create a stick shape and pinch the edges to seal them.
- Place the cheesy taco sticks on a parchment-lined baking sheet.
- Beat the egg in a small bowl and brush it over the top of each stick for a golden-brown finish.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es or until golden brown and crispy.
- Remove from the oven and allow to cool slightly before serving.
💡 Chef's Notes
Serve warm with sour cream and salsa for dipping. Garnish with extra green onions.
